The Spain Agricultural Machinery Market is projected to witness mixed growth rate patterns during 2025 to 2029. The growth rate starts at 3.38% in 2025 and reaches 5.42% by 2029.
The Spain agricultural machinery market is characterized by a diverse range of equipment catering to the country`s varied agricultural landscape. The market encompasses a wide array of machinery such as tractors, harvesters, plows, and planters, driven by the country`s emphasis on modernizing its agricultural practices for increased efficiency and productivity. Key players in the market include both domestic manufacturers and international brands, offering a mix of technologically advanced and cost-effective solutions to meet the needs of Spanish farmers. Factors such as government subsidies, farm consolidation, and the adoption of precision farming techniques are driving the growth of the agricultural machinery market in Spain. The market is expected to continue expanding as farmers seek to optimize their operations and remain competitive in the global agricultural sector.
In the Spain Agricultural machinery market, there is a growing trend towards the adoption of precision farming technologies, such as GPS guidance systems and remote sensing tools, to optimize crop yields and reduce input costs. Farmers are increasingly investing in advanced machinery like autonomous tractors and drones for monitoring and managing their fields efficiently. Sustainability is also a key focus, with a rising demand for eco-friendly machinery that minimizes environmental impact. Additionally, there is a shift towards digitization and data-driven decision-making, with more farmers leveraging data analytics and farm management software to improve productivity and profitability. Overall, the Spain Agricultural machinery market is witnessing a transformation towards smarter, more sustainable, and technologically advanced solutions to meet the evolving needs of the agriculture industry.
In the Spain Agricultural machinery market, one of the key challenges faced is the rapidly changing technological landscape. Farmers are often overwhelmed by the plethora of options available in terms of advanced machinery and equipment, making it difficult for them to choose the most suitable and cost-effective solutions for their specific needs. Additionally, the high initial investment required for purchasing modern agricultural machinery can be a barrier for small and medium-sized farmers, leading to a slower adoption rate of new technologies. Furthermore, the lack of proper training and technical support for using these advanced machines efficiently can also hinder the overall growth and productivity in the sector. To overcome these challenges, companies in the Spain Agricultural machinery market need to focus on providing comprehensive guidance, training programs, and financial assistance to farmers to facilitate the smooth transition towards modernization.

In Spain, the government has implemented various policies to support the agricultural machinery market. These include providing subsidies and grants to farmers to invest in modern and efficient machinery, with a focus on promoting sustainability and environmental protection. Additionally, there are regulations in place to ensure the safety and quality standards of agricultural machinery, as well as initiatives to promote research and development in the sector. The government also works to facilitate access to financing for farmers looking to purchase machinery through partnerships with financial institutions. Overall, these policies aim to modernize the agricultural sector, improve productivity, and ensure the competitiveness of Spanish agriculture in the global market.
